Pathway
Menu
Get in Touch
Conveniently located 15 miles from Buffalo and 12 miles from Niagara Falls.
2935 Fix Road
Grand Island, NY 14072
(716) 773-2943
[email protected]
Home
News
Services
Team
Contact
Home
News
Services
Team
Contact